Across TCGA cell cohorts, SVOP RNA expression is significantly associated with the go_rna of many other GO terms, with 1,002 significant associations in total. LUNG_SCLC shows the largest number of these associations.

The most reproducible SVOP-associated GO terms across cancer lineages are Regulation of syncytium formation by plasma membrane fusion, Regulation of myoblast fusion, and Negative regulation of myoblast fusion. Each is linked with SVOP in more than 4 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both SVOP-to-partner and partner-to-SVOP results are reported.

Each partner links to its own Q-omics profile. The box plot shows the strongest example, Regulation of syncytium formation by plasma membrane fusion grouped by SVOP-low versus SVOP-high in LUNG_SCLC.
